This is a small implementation of the Drunken Bishop algorithm for generating those random art images you see for SSH key fingerprints. It was mostly for my own edification. There's a library that exposes a function
drunkenBishop :: Data.ByteString.Lazy.ByteString -> String
which performs an MD5 hash of the input and then uses that hash to guide the Drunken Bishop algorithm. There's also an executable that reads stdin
and formats the output image in an ASCII art frame.
